Proactive news snapshot: Papua Mining, Midatech Pharma, Sound Energy …

A glance at some of the day's highlights from the Proactive Investors newswire

Papua Mining PLC (LON:PML) has said that geophysics survey at the Marengo gold/copper project has defined quasi linear IP and resistivity anomalies at One Mile Mountain, which may be related to high gold zones sitting on the edge of deeper porphyry system.

Midatech Pharma Plc (LON:MTPH, NASDAQ:MTP) said patient enrolment has begun for a clinical trial that could expand the market for its cancer treatment. Gelclair is already prescribed for an after effect of radiation and chemo therapies called oral mucositis, a painful and debilitating inflammation and ulceration of the surface of the mouth.

Sound Energy PLC (LON:SOU) told investors it has applied for a development concession for the Tendrara gas discovery. It marks another step towards taking Tendrara into production, following on from the week’s earlier news that it reached an agreement with a key contractor for front end engineering design to develop gas infrastructure.

Strategic Minerals Plc (LON:SML) (USOTC:SMCDY) has agreed amended the contract with the major client of its Southern Minerals Group (SMG) subsidiary at the Cobre magnetite stockpile in New Mexico, USA. It added that the client is to pay SMG, quarterly in advance, a non-refundable prepayment of US$375,000 against future deliveries, with payments due in June, September and December 2018.

Thor Mining PLC (LON:THR, ASX:THR) said the proposed sale of its interest in USA Lithium to Hawkstone Mining Limited (ASX:HWK) has been delayed. The meeting of Hawkstone shareholders to approve the acquisition has been deferred and is now scheduled for 28 June 2018.

Airport and energy group Stobart Group Limited (LON:STOB) has rescheduled its Annual Meeting for 6 July. Former chief executive Andrew Tinkler has already indicated he will vote against the re-election of chairman Ian Ferguson and has put forward well-known retail entrepreneur Philip Day as his replacement.

HemoGenyx Pharmaceuticals PLC (LON:HEMO), the biotechnology company developing novel therapies to transform bone marrow, or blood stem cell, transplantation for the treatment of blood diseases, is to hold a presentation for investors on Tuesday 26th June 2018. The group said the briefing by Dr. Vladislav Sandler, CEO of Hemogenyx, will take place at Copper Bar, Balls Brothers, 6 Adams Court, Old Broad Street, EC2N 1DX from 4.30pm for a 4.45pm start and will be followed by drinks and networking.

Tlou Energy Limited (LON:TLOU), the AIM and ASX listed company focused on delivering power in Botswana and Southern Africa through the development of coal bed methane projects, has today issued letters to eligible and ineligible shareholders regarding the non-renounceable entitlement offer announced on 6 June 2018.

Thor Mining PLC (LONLTHR) today announced on the Australian Securities Exchange the closure, on Friday 1 June 2018, of the CHESS Depositary Interest (CDI) Sale Facility for holders of less than a marketable parcel of CDIs in the company. The ASX Listing Rules defines a "Marketable Parcel" as those holdings of CDIs with a market value of A$500 or more.

Cadence Minerals (LON:KDNC) (OTC:KDNCY) reports that Macarthur Minerals Limited (TSX-V:MMS) has completed a heliborne SkyTEM electromagnetic survey programme targeting gold and copper at its Hillside Gold Project in the Pilbara region of Western Australia, to define high priority targets from conductors such as clusters of massive sulphide-hosted base metal deposits at depth. Cadence has a 15.2% equity interest in Macarthur.
